package com.mbridge.msdk.playercommon.exoplayer2.upstream;
import android.net.Uri;
import java.io.IOException;
import java.net.DatagramPacket;
import java.net.DatagramSocket;
import java.net.InetAddress;
import java.net.InetSocketAddress;
import java.net.MulticastSocket;
import java.net.SocketException;
/* loaded from: classes4.dex */
public final class UdpDataSource implements DataSource {
public static final int DEAFULT_SOCKET_TIMEOUT_MILLIS = 8000;
public static final int DEFAULT_MAX_PACKET_SIZE = 2000;
private InetAddress address;
private final TransferListener<? super UdpDataSource> listener;
private MulticastSocket multicastSocket;
private boolean opened;
private final DatagramPacket packet;
private final byte[] packetBuffer;
private int packetRemaining;
private DatagramSocket socket;
private InetSocketAddress socketAddress;
private final int socketTimeoutMillis;
private Uri uri;
@Override // com.mbridge.msdk.playercommon.exoplayer2.upstream.DataSource
public final Uri getUri() {
return this.uri;
}
public static final class UdpDataSourceException extends IOException {
public UdpDataSourceException(IOException iOException) {
super(iOException);
}
}
public UdpDataSource(TransferListener<? super UdpDataSource> transferListener) {
this(transferListener, 2000);
}
public UdpDataSource(TransferListener<? super UdpDataSource> transferListener, int i) {
this(transferListener, i, 8000);
}
public UdpDataSource(TransferListener<? super UdpDataSource> transferListener, int i, int i2) {
this.listener = transferListener;
this.socketTimeoutMillis = i2;
byte[] bArr = new byte[i];
this.packetBuffer = bArr;
this.packet = new DatagramPacket(bArr, 0, i);
}
@Override // com.mbridge.msdk.playercommon.exoplayer2.upstream.DataSource
public final long open(DataSpec dataSpec) throws UdpDataSourceException {
Uri uri = dataSpec.uri;
this.uri = uri;
String host = uri.getHost();
int port = this.uri.getPort();
try {
this.address = InetAddress.getByName(host);
this.socketAddress = new InetSocketAddress(this.address, port);
if (this.address.isMulticastAddress()) {
MulticastSocket multicastSocket = new MulticastSocket(this.socketAddress);
this.multicastSocket = multicastSocket;
multicastSocket.joinGroup(this.address);
this.socket = this.multicastSocket;
} else {
this.socket = new DatagramSocket(this.socketAddress);
}
try {
this.socket.setSoTimeout(this.socketTimeoutMillis);
this.opened = true;
TransferListener<? super UdpDataSource> transferListener = this.listener;
if (transferListener == null) {
return -1L;
}
transferListener.onTransferStart(this, dataSpec);
return -1L;
} catch (SocketException e) {
throw new UdpDataSourceException(e);
}
} catch (IOException e2) {
throw new UdpDataSourceException(e2);
}
}
@Override // com.mbridge.msdk.playercommon.exoplayer2.upstream.DataSource
public final int read(byte[] bArr, int i, int i2) throws UdpDataSourceException {
if (i2 == 0) {
return 0;
}
if (this.packetRemaining == 0) {
try {
this.socket.receive(this.packet);
int length = this.packet.getLength();
this.packetRemaining = length;
TransferListener<? super UdpDataSource> transferListener = this.listener;
if (transferListener != null) {
transferListener.onBytesTransferred(this, length);
}
} catch (IOException e) {
throw new UdpDataSourceException(e);
}
}
int length2 = this.packet.getLength();
int i3 = this.packetRemaining;
int min = Math.min(i3, i2);
System.arraycopy(this.packetBuffer, length2 - i3, bArr, i, min);
this.packetRemaining -= min;
return min;
}
@Override // com.mbridge.msdk.playercommon.exoplayer2.upstream.DataSource
public final void close() {
this.uri = null;
MulticastSocket multicastSocket = this.multicastSocket;
if (multicastSocket != null) {
try {
multicastSocket.leaveGroup(this.address);
} catch (IOException unused) {
}
this.multicastSocket = null;
}
DatagramSocket datagramSocket = this.socket;
if (datagramSocket != null) {
datagramSocket.close();
this.socket = null;
}
this.address = null;
this.socketAddress = null;
this.packetRemaining = 0;
if (this.opened) {
this.opened = false;
TransferListener<? super UdpDataSource> transferListener = this.listener;
if (transferListener != null) {
transferListener.onTransferEnd(this);
}
}
}
}
